"The pioneering South Korean news site posts hundreds of stories every day -- most are written by housewives, schoolkids, professors and other "citizen journalists." Founder Oh Yeon-Ho says his site is changing the definition of journalism -- and who can be a journalist." I've been trying to find a good article on this website but only stumbled on this interview now, from the Japan Media Review. This is an example of how the internet does change everything, in this case, expanding the idea of journalism.
